Understanding Generator Over Current Relay


In modern electrical engineering, safeguarding equipment against faults is of paramount importance. One crucial component in this protective scheme is the over current relay, particularly in generator applications. This device plays a vital role in ensuring the reliability and longevity of generators by preventing damage that could result from excessive current draw.


What is an Over Current Relay?


An over current relay is a protective device designed to detect abnormal current levels in electrical circuits, signaling the need for immediate corrective action. Typically, it operates on the principle of sensing current, comparing it to a predetermined set point, and activating a protective mechanism once the current exceeds this threshold. In the context of generators, these relays offer dual functionality - they protect the generator unit itself as well as the connected load.


The Importance of Protecting Generators


Generators are integral to various applications, from providing backup power to commercial establishments to serving as primary power sources in remote locations. However, they are not immune to faults, such as short circuits or overloads, which can lead to severe damage. An over current relay serves as the first line of defense against these potentially catastrophic events. By promptly disconnecting the affected circuit when an overcurrent condition is detected, these relays help to prevent overheating and mechanical stress on the generator, which could culminate in costly repairs or replacements.


How Does an Over Current Relay Work?

The operation of an over current relay is relatively straightforward yet effective. Upon installation, the relay is calibrated to recognize the normal operating current levels of the generator. It continuously monitors the current flowing through the generator and its associated circuits. When the current exceeds the predetermined limit — which can vary depending on the generator's capacity and the specific application — the relay sends a signal to trip the circuit breaker. This interruption stops the current flow, thereby protecting the generator from further damage.


There are generally two types of over current relays instantaneous and time-delay relays. Instantaneous relays respond almost immediately to overcurrent conditions, making them suitable for protecting generator circuits against short circuits. Time-delay relays, on the other hand, provide a buffer period that allows temporary current spikes — often caused by inrush currents during startup — to dissipate without tripping unnecessarily. This selective coordination ensures that only the faulty section of the network is isolated while maintaining overall system stability.
